**_About Northern Trust:_** Northern Trust, a Fortune 500 company, is a globally recognized, award-winning financial institution that has been in continuous operation since 1889. Northern Trust is proud to provide innovative financial services and guidance to the world’s most successful individuals, families, and institutions by remaining true to our enduring principles of service, expertise, and integrity. With more than 130 years of financial experience and over 22,000 partners, we serve the world’s most sophisticated clients using leading technology and exceptional service. Role: Under general supervision (but works independently most of the time) responsible for handling and coordinating work for the Financial Reporting group within the Asset Servicing group. AS is a team of global service financial professionals that has operational capabilities in all locations. AS encompasses Valuation Reporting and Unitized Valuation and Reporting Service and is comprised of partners who support Northern Trust business in conjunction with our global network of operational partners. How to Apply on Workday
- Workday has a multi-step form — save your progress after every section.
- "Apply With LinkedIn" can fail or lose data; manual entry is more reliable.
- Watch for the "Submit for Review" final step — hitting "Save" alone does not submit.
- Job requisition numbers are useful when following up with HR by email.
